February 18, 200818 yr Moderator Well, as it turns out Richard S. emailed me with the answer...It seems that if you are parked within the bounds of a "refueling area" this will occur. Once you've moved far enough to be outside that area, the doors will work correctly.It seems that the "bounds" of the stock refueling areas is considerably oversized, since where I'm parked in a default SMALL GA space adjacent to the fuel pumps at KLAF (Perdue University, Lafayette, IN) at the moment.
